My Gf and I are currently building a keto for her to drift, i thought I'd put up a project thread, we're building it and doing all the fabrication work between ourselves (it helps that both our dads own engineering companies :whistling: )

Big thanks to Ric at Upgarge/ProjectD for helping us out with lots of parts etc!

To start with it'll be NA, then going turbo when she's learnt a bit more ;)

Specs (ish) -

Engine/driveline:

- Sr20de conversion
- Custom Engine/gearbox mounts
- Custom trans tunnel
- S13 turbo flywheel/HD clutch/gearbox
- Manual KE70 pedal box with Celica clutch master cylinder.
- Custom 1 piece tailshaft
- Welded standard diff (for now), then hoping to go R31 with disks when the stock diff breaks
- Custom Surge tank, random ford lifter pump, R33 turbo main pump
- S13 turbo radiator/thermo's
- Low mount turbo exhaust manifold (gonna use that with out a turbo for now, saves buying 2 manifolds)
- Custom straight through exhaust, with the biggest hot dog resonator I can get


Interior:

- Fixed back bucket seat
- 4 point harness
- Custom aluminium dash/switch panel
- Completely stripped, will be resprayed at some point
- Full weld in cage in the future
- Aluminium door skins and rear seat/parcel shelf panel thingo

Exterior

- Respray in something (GF wants red, or satin black or something)
- Random jap 14's
- Flared guards
- Fendor mirrors (If i can talk her into them)
- Possibly chrome bumpers or even ae86 front

Suspension:

- S13 front coilovers/hub/LCA's (I'm looking at buying a brand new pair of ISC's)
- S13 sr20det front brakes
- Ford rear springs (picked up some random king heavy duty ones from Pick and payless, gonna see if they fit), cut to height
- Lowered commodore KYB shocks
- Front and rear whiteline sway bars

So far we've got the engine in, the interior stripped out, and I'm starting on some of the custom stuff this week. We're just interested in getting it running first, then do some exterior work/cage etc later on.

Why the need for the custom tunnel?

An SR and box fits in the stock tunnel no worries... and if using an RB box no need to cut out the shifter hole also.

I'm doing the same conversion atm to my Daily... KE70 with S14 VVT NA SR. Using the s14 crossmember it all drops in way too easy ;)

The pictures don't show it too well, but we mived the engine quite far back, also it allows us to remove the gearbox without removing the whole engine. That and we got carried away with the angle grinder ;) The car won't be registered either.

I had heard the ISC N1's to be quite good? At least in an S13? I've already bought the hubs/brakes, and have the LCA's out of my old R31 skyline (not S13 as I said before.) They are approx 20-30mm longer each side, so I might have to extend or make custom tie rod ends also.
